The AT899 is a superminiature condenser microphone designed to be worn on performers' clothing, ties, or hair accessories, providing superior sound quality without hindering appearance. When wearing it on a tie, please position the microphone holder about 150mm below the neck. To avoid noise caused by clothing touching the microphone, ensure the holder does not come into contact with other clothing.
The individual and dual microphone brackets can be easily swapped between all bases. To reduce wind noise when the AT899 microphone is used for close-talk recording, please use the included windscreen. This also helps to reduce wind noise in the recording environment. Additionally, please use the included microphone head protector to prevent accidentally dropping metal fragments or iron shavings into the microphone head.
The AT899 microphone requires operation with 11V to 52V phantom power or 1.5V AA batteries. When using phantom power, batteries are not required to be installed.
The XLRM connector on the power supply module features a low-impedance balanced output. The microphone audio signal is output via the 2nd and 3rd pins of the XLR male connector, while the 1st pin is connected to ground (shield). The output phase will be set to positive phase level on the 2nd pin.
AT899 Technical Specifications

| Component | Fixed charging back panel, polarity capacitor microphone head |
| Directional | Omni-directional directional |
| Frequency Response | 20~20,000 Hz |
| High-pass filter | 80 Hz, 12 dB/octave |
| Open-path sensitivity | Phantom Power: -43 dB (7.0 mV) at 1V into 1 Pa, Battery: -46 dB (5.0 mV) at 1V into 1 Pa |
| Impedance | Imaginary Power Supply: 200 Ohms, Battery: 250 Ohms |
| Input Sound Pressure Level | Imaginary Power Supply: 138 dB Sound Pressure, 1 kHz at 1% T.H.D. Battery: 116 dB Sound Pressure, 1 kHz at 1% T.H.D. |
| Dynamic Range (Typical Value) | Phantom Power: 108 dB, 1 kHz at high sound pressure; Battery: 86 dB, 1 kHz at high sound pressure |
| Imaginary Power Supply | Direct current 11~52V, power consumption 2mA typical |
| Battery | 1.5V AA 5-cell battery |
| Battery Consumption / Lifespan | 0.4mA / 1,200 hours (alkaline battery) |
| Switch | Flat, High-pass Filter (Slot Switch) |
| Weight | Microphone: 0.5g Power Module: 102g |
| Dimensions | Microphone: 16.0mm long, 5.0mm diameter Power module: 145.0mm long, 21.0mm diameter |
| Output Terminal | Built-in 3-pin XLRM Cannon male connector |
| Conductor | 3.0 m in length, 2.0 mm in diameter, microphone fixed connection, 2-core wire with shielded wire, connected to the TB3M socket of the power module with a TA3F plug. |
| Standard Configuration | AT8537 Power Module; AT8539 Connector Pin; Clothing Pin Base; Snake Pin Base; Magnetic Pin Base with Metal Sheet and Tie String; 3 Single Microphone Stands; 2 Dual Microphone Stands; 2 Radio Head Protection Caps; 2 Windproof Cotton Covers; Battery; Protective Bag |
